Output d4f090bbf2424cc32c17470d79fe8bbf29164eaae1becd2264acf2deb103564d:0

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d56df9892a99d56bcebde0e67effb4039d5bc24 OP_EQUAL
address
3LQkWwUwjkax5v8pNwn8TXhCSLeVkbh2PW
transaction
d4f090bbf2424cc32c17470d79fe8bbf29164eaae1becd2264acf2deb103564d
spent
true